CI note: the Driftpane diff viewer job times out on files over 40MB because the tokenizer runs single-threaded. If the pipeline stalls at the render stage, rerun with the chunked-diff flag enabled rather than bumping the timeout — the timeout masks a memory leak we're still tracking. The fix was validated on the build recorded below.

trace token, fafog-kageg: htk4_98e6

Quick note for support: when Chirpline's notification fan-out hits backpressure, you'll see queued sends pile up in the Fanvale dashboard — that's the system deliberately slowing down, not a crash. Don't restart workers; just watch the drain rate. If you need to query the internal Fanvale API yourself to check queue depth, use the key right below.

API key for kahop-bagef: zpat2_yb

Subject: DR drill — GateTally turnstile counter

Team,

Next Thursday we'll run the quarterly disaster-recovery drill for GateTally, the turnstile counter service at Harrowfield Stadium. We'll simulate a full loss of the primary count aggregator and restore from the cold standby in the Verlane region. Expect roughly forty minutes of degraded entry metrics; gates stay operational. As release manager, please freeze deploys from 09:00 to 11:00. To unlock the standby vault during the drill, use the passphrase below.

vault phrase of kawep-tahog = ulaix-briath